Incident Reports:

February 19 Deputy Sheriff/School Resource Officer Mike Lewis filed a report with this office of a juvenile removed from a local public school due to alleged possession of marijuana.  The parent(s) were contacted as was the juvenile officer.  School authorities are handing administrative duties and the case is being reported to juvenile office.

February 21 LCSO continued a sex offense investigation from August 2020.  Additional leads had surfaced and have been followed up on.

February 22 LCSO investigated a report of property damage to a mail box in Dawn.  Unknown person(s) struck the mailbox and destroyed it.  Investigation continues.

February 23 LCSO received information on a registered sex offender that resides in another county allegedly not complying with all registration requirements.  The proper sheriff's office was contacted and given all information.

February 24 LCSO began investigation of Hindering Prosecution in that one or more people allegedly provided material aid (vehicle and information of law enforcement looking for the suspect) to a felon fugitive knowing the person was wanted by authorities.  Investigation continues. 

February 24 LCSO responded to Avalon on a report of elder abuse.  Investigation shows elderly female and another woman had been arguing and gotten into an altercation.  An ambulance was summoned for the elderly woman who refused treatment and refused to cooperate with deputies.  No further investigation.

February 24 at 11:41 a.m. a deputy attempted to stop a vehicle for traffic offense in Chillicothe and the driver had a revoked/suspended driver's license.  The driver initially attempted to use the vehicle to flee from the deputy.  Once stopped the driver was reportedly belligerent and uncooperative and the deputy noticed the driver allegedly throw out a baggie containing methamphetamine.  The investigation shows the suspect appears to have torn open the baggie with his mouth and may have ingested methamphetamine prior to tossing the bag out and in attempt to tamper with evidence.   LCSO is seeking charges for the alleged methamphetamine possession and tampering with physical evidence.  The suspect is in currently in custody on other warrant at this time.

February 25 LCSO received information of a local registered sex offender allegedly having not complied with a written request from the Missouri State Highway Patrol Sex Offender Unit.  Additional investigation is taking place and report will be submitted to our prosecuting attorney for consideration.

Additional Information:

Multiple times this week the LCSO was dispatched to wrong way drivers on U.S. 36.  One of the calls was a person headed our direction from location in Caldwell County at over 100 miles per hour traveling east in the west bound lanes.  None of the vehicles were found in Livingston County.

This week LCSO responded to call on U.S. 36 of a stolen vehicle from Cameron traveling this direction.  The matter was resolved before it arrived in Livingston County.

LCSO obtained information on location of a federal fugitive wanted for major methamphetamine violation(s).  A search of a home in Livingston County and investigation shows we missed the fugitive only by minutes.  Information shared with area agencies and NITRO Task Force.  Fugitive later apprehended in Caldwell County.

LCSO has been working on various fugitive investigations this week in attempt to serve multiple arrest warrants and information shared with several agencies on these cases.

LCSO had critical incident debriefing earlier this week regarding lethal use of force.

LCSO had a full department meeting this week where all staff were in attendance.  Various topics of discussion, assignments, training and investigations were discussed.

LCSO recently received permission from the Livingston County Commission to order a 2021 Dodge Charger AWD Police Pursuit Vehicle from Woody's after bids were received and inspected.

LCSO has received our patrol vehicle back from the Missouri State Highway Patrol after their examination from the officer involved shooting on the 19th.  The vehicle remains out of service due to damage and not being operable at this time.  We are obtaining estimates for repairs at this time.
